I am excited to be running for a third two year term on the Town Council, and hope I will receive your support. The Forecast contains my statement that sets out a number of initiatives I’ve been engaged in during the past four years, and that I look forward to working on – and hopefully concluding! – during the next term. Most of you are no doubt familiar with much of this work, on matters such as turning the adjacent surface parking lots to parks, mitigating the impact of the Purple Line, developing Zimmerman into a successful multi-use park, and improving pedestrian safety and traffic management.
